Ingredients (original text)

pork (90%), water, rice flour, sea salt, chickpea flour, sugar, stabiliser: diphosphates, white pepper, dried ginger, dried mace, dried nutmeg, dried cayenne pepper, cornflour, preservative: sodium metabisulphite, yeast extract, dried sage, dried thyme, antioxidants: ascorbic acid, sodium ascorbate, dextrose, dried onions, rapeseed oil, flavouring, filled into vegetable based casings (calcium alginate)

Nutritional information

Classic sausage contains 331.6 calories per 100g, with 16g of protein, 27.9g of fat, and 2.3g of carbohydrates (0.9g of which is sugar).
